Express Scripts Inc was awarded a federal contract by Department Of Health And Human Services (Office Of Assistant Secretary For Preparedness And Response) on April 20, 2016 for an undisclosed amount of work in claims adjusting. It was awarded under full and open competition. The contract has been modified 15 times since the base award It uses order dependent (idv allows pricing arrangement to be determined separately for each order) contract pricing. The most recent modification was on September 11, 2021. If all options are exercised, the contract could reach $40.97 million.
